basbousa
  67

It is the Arabic name of a sweet or dessert of Turkish origin. It exists in Egypt and many Mediterranean countries. It is made with grit and bathed in syrup. It is also called basbusa, Egyptian basbusa, revani or ravani and revani, as well as hareesa or harise. You can add coconut or yogurt.
